1. The “Mum Hack” for Cleaning Baby Bottles

Cleaning baby bottles can be time-consuming and tedious, but a TikTok video by a mother of four has revolutionized the process. The “mum hack” involves filling a washing-up bowl with hot water and adding a dishwasher tablet. The baby bottles are then placed in the water, and the solution does the work for you, leaving the bottles sparkling clean in minutes.

3. The “Pool Noodle” for Childproofing

Childproofing your home can be challenging, and the cost of buying safety equipment can add up. A mum on TikTok has shared a hack that involves using pool noodles to childproof your home. The pool noodles can be cut into sections and placed on sharp table corners, door edges, and other potential hazards.

4. The “Toy Shelf” for Organizing Children’s Toys

Children’s toys can quickly take over your home, and finding a way to organize them can be a daunting task. A TikTok parent has shared a “toy shelf” hack that has gone viral. The hack involves using a shelving unit with plastic storage bins to organize your child’s toys. The bins can be labeled with pictures or words to make it easier for children to recognize and return their toys.

5. The “Night Light” for Better Sleep

Getting your child to sleep can be a challenge, and sometimes a small tweak to the environment can make all the difference. A TikTok parent has shared a “night light” hack that creates a soothing environment for children to fall asleep. The hack involves placing glow-in-the-dark stars on the ceiling and walls of your child’s room. The stars absorb light during the day and emit a soft glow at night, creating a calming ambiance that is conducive to sleep.
